关于目标检测的模型有很多,nanodet模型小且轻量化,适合移植部署到硬件设备上,非常推荐学习这个模型。经过我自己踩了无数坑后总结了此教程,助学刚接触nanodet,想要快速上手的学者,教程很详细,学者耐心看。目录一、准备nanodet框架二、安装训练必要的库文件1、必要库文件2、torch和torchvison的版本对应问题3、坑三、安装nanodet包四、数据集制作1、VOC格式数据集2、数据增强3、VOC格式数据集转COCO格式数据集4、坑五、训练数据集1、配置文件的修改2、开始训练六、测试训练好的模型1、检测图片2、检测视频3、调用电脑摄像头七、总结一、准备nanodet框架我提供了一
区块链本质上是一个去中心化的分布式账本数据库。其本身是一串使用密码学相关联所产生的数据块,每一个数据块中包含了多次交易有效确认的信息。区块链优缺点:优点:1、去中心化,不需要第三方权威机构。2、数据不可篡改,数据一旦存入区块,将永久存储,数据具有极高的稳定性和可靠性。(此特点也是缺点,数据不可撤销。)3、自制性,算法公开透明,人为干预不起作用。4、开放性,数据完全开放,任何节点都可以查询区块链内所有数据。(此特点也算缺点,可以查询某个账户所有交易数据。)5、匿名性,交易时无需公开身份让对方相信自己。(此特点也算缺点,由于无需公开身份交易,又无需担心交易过程,受到不少不法分子的喜爱。)缺点:1、
区块链本质上是一个去中心化的分布式账本数据库。其本身是一串使用密码学相关联所产生的数据块,每一个数据块中包含了多次交易有效确认的信息。区块链优缺点:优点:1、去中心化,不需要第三方权威机构。2、数据不可篡改,数据一旦存入区块,将永久存储,数据具有极高的稳定性和可靠性。(此特点也是缺点,数据不可撤销。)3、自制性,算法公开透明,人为干预不起作用。4、开放性,数据完全开放,任何节点都可以查询区块链内所有数据。(此特点也算缺点,可以查询某个账户所有交易数据。)5、匿名性,交易时无需公开身份让对方相信自己。(此特点也算缺点,由于无需公开身份交易,又无需担心交易过程,受到不少不法分子的喜爱。)缺点:1、
如何通俗地理解相似矩阵同学们大家好,今天我们来学习相似矩阵。1简单印象设 都是 阶方阵,若有可逆矩阵 ,使得:则称 为相似变换矩阵(Similaritytransformationmatrix),称 是 的相似矩阵(Similarmatrix),记作:既然相似,则一定有相同点,相同点是什么呢?它们是同一个线性映射,在不同基下的代数表达。 2解释我们知道,线性映射是将一个向量映射到另一个向量,比如这里将 ,映射成 。2.1自然基将 在自然基下的坐标向量用 表示, 在自然基下的坐标向量用 表示。矩阵 就是将坐标向量 ,映射到坐标向量 。这里坐标向量 ,坐标向量 ,矩阵 就是把 转换为2.2非自然基
transformer中QKV的通俗理解(渣男与备胎的故事)用vit的时候读了一下transformer的思想,前几天面试结束之后发现对QKV又有点忘记了,写一篇文章来记录一下参考链接:哔哩哔哩:在线激情讲解transformer&Attention注意力机制(上)Attentionisallyouneed介绍更具体的介绍可以去阅读论文在Attentionisallyouneed这篇文章中提出了著名的Transformer模型Transformer中抛弃了传统的CNN和RNN,整个网络结构完全是由Attention机制组成。更准确地讲,Transformer由且仅由self-Attenion和
transformer中QKV的通俗理解(渣男与备胎的故事)用vit的时候读了一下transformer的思想,前几天面试结束之后发现对QKV又有点忘记了,写一篇文章来记录一下参考链接:哔哩哔哩:在线激情讲解transformer&Attention注意力机制(上)Attentionisallyouneed介绍更具体的介绍可以去阅读论文在Attentionisallyouneed这篇文章中提出了著名的Transformer模型Transformer中抛弃了传统的CNN和RNN,整个网络结构完全是由Attention机制组成。更准确地讲,Transformer由且仅由self-Attenion和
这个问题在这里已经有了答案:WhatisJSONP,andwhywasitcreated?(10个答案)关闭4年前。我知道JSONP是带填充的JSON。我了解什么是JSON,以及如何将其与jQuery.getJSON()一起使用.但是,在引入JSONP时,我不理解callback的概念。谁能给我解释一下这是怎么回事?
这个问题在这里已经有了答案:WhatisJSONP,andwhywasitcreated?(10个答案)关闭4年前。我知道JSONP是带填充的JSON。我了解什么是JSON,以及如何将其与jQuery.getJSON()一起使用.但是,在引入JSONP时,我不理解callback的概念。谁能给我解释一下这是怎么回事?
NFT是一种数字化代币或者资产,可以把它理解为一种数字交易代币或者数字艺术品,每当你购买一个NFT,实际上你买的是这个数字资产的所有权。NFT翻译为非同质化代币,每个NFT生成以后不能更改,它一定是和其他的数字资产不一样,例如一个比特币一定是和另一个比特币是完全一样,而每个NFT都是不一样的,实际上一个NFT的背后只是一串随机生成的代码,NFT拥有者只是拥有了一串永远不变并且唯一性的代码,那么在技术层面的NFT到底是什么?NFT实际上就是一串代码指向到一个数字地址,谁获得了这串代码的密码,谁的地址就拥有了这串代码,这串代码可以被买卖交易到不同的数字地址,这串代码是被区块链所认证,你可以查看每一
文章目录一、SVM是什么?二、使用步骤三、SVM分类算法的Python代码示例总结一、SVM是什么?SVM(支持向量机,SupportVectorMachine)是一种非常流行的机器学习算法,可用于二分类和多分类问题。其基本思想是通过在不同类别的样本之间构建最大化分类间隔的线性或非线性超平面来实现分类。二、使用步骤SVM分类的基本步骤如下:根据训练集数据,选取最优的超平面(通常为线性或非线性),使得该平面划分出的两个类别中存在最大的间隔距离。对新数据进行预测时,将其投射到该最优超平面上,并根据其所处的位置判定其属于哪个类别。三、SVM分类算法的Python代码示例代码如下(示例):fromsk